Output d2029c606751060325d27dd58f30b632b6d64225b7bc487eb48247435781458d:0
- value
- 18864703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 820d340a24c763e4c99ab069852112f66db7741c OP_EQUAL
- address
- 3DYfarvurqkAhm4ZsR1h6cH6B9sqHETQNU
- transaction
- d2029c606751060325d27dd58f30b632b6d64225b7bc487eb48247435781458d
- confirmations
- 277731
- spent
- true